Ramp Replacement Questions
What are signs that a ramp needs replacement? Visible damage, such as cracks, corrosion, or loose components, indicates a need for replacement to ensure safety and functionality.
How does a ramp replacement improve accessibility? Replacing an old or damaged ramp provides a smooth, stable surface that makes it easier for wheelchairs, walkers, and mobility aids to navigate.
What types of ramps can be replaced? Various types, including wood, aluminum, and concrete ramps, can be replaced to suit different property needs and aesthetic preferences.
Is ramp replacement suitable for all property types? Yes, ramp replacement services are available for residential, commercial, and public properties to enhance accessibility and safety.
